Description

Traces the process of racialization for both the Native American and wider North Carolinian populations in the decades that followed the Tuscarora War, using previously undiscovered material to chart the dehumanization that occurred as well as the repercussions of the tributary policies that were still felt nearly 200 years after the conflict.
